Meet the Buyer North to return for the ninth year

July 2, 2026 by No Comments | Category Procurement news, Scottish Procurement, SMEs, suppliers

Meet the Buyer North is once again set to bring businesses together for the largest free procurement event in the North of Scotland.

The Supplier Development Programme will host the ninth annual Meet the Buyer North event on Thursday 3 September 2026, at The Music Hall, in Aberdeen.

Partnered by the Scottish Government, this free networking event allows businesses to connect with key public sector buyers and decision-makers. Attendees will have the opportunity to speak directly with the buyers on the exhibition stands to learn about upcoming contracts and opportunities in the North of Scotland.

In addition to engaging with buyers, attendees on the day will also have the chance to learn about the business support available, to help them expand their skills, grow their business and improve their chances of winning work.

On the day, suppliers will have the opportunity to listen to presentations and workshops delivered by a range of procurement professionals and buyers.

While SDP’s Meet the Buyer events are aimed at micro, small and medium-sized organisations, businesses of all sizes are welcome to attend.
